Early Life and Background

William Bradley Pitt was born on December 18, 1963, in Shawnee, Oklahoma, USA. He was raised in Springfield, Missouri, by his parents, William Alvin Pitt, a trucking company owner, and Jane Etta, a school counselor. Brad grew up in a conservative household with his younger siblings, Doug and Julie.

Pitt attended the University of Missouri, majoring in journalism with a focus on advertising. However, just two credits short of graduation, he left college and moved to Los Angeles to pursue acting. To support himself, he worked odd jobs, including chauffeuring strippers and dressing up as a chicken for a fast-food restaurant.


Breakthrough in Acting

Pitt’s first noticeable role came in the 1991 film Thelma & Louise, where he played a charming drifter named J.D. Although it was a small role, his charisma and screen presence captured public attention and made him a Hollywood heartthrob overnight.

Soon after, Pitt began landing leading roles in films like A River Runs Through It (1992) and Legends of the Fall (1994). These films highlighted his talent and established him as a rising star.


Rise to Stardom

Throughout the 1990s, Pitt demonstrated his ability to take on diverse roles. In Seven (1995), he played Detective David Mills, opposite Morgan Freeman, in a gripping crime thriller that became a classic. He further proved his range with roles in 12 Monkeys (1995), for which he earned his first Academy Award nomination, and Fight Club (1999), which remains one of his most iconic performances.


Continued Success in the 2000s

In the 2000s, Pitt became an A-list star, appearing in big-budget films such as Troy (2004) and the Ocean’s Eleven trilogy, alongside George Clooney and Matt Damon. His role as Achilles in Troy showcased his action star credentials, while Mr. & Mrs. Smith (2005) opposite Angelina Jolie not only became a box office hit but also sparked one of Hollywood’s most talked-about relationships.


Acclaimed Productions and Awards

In addition to acting, Pitt co-founded the production company Plan B Entertainment, which produced several award-winning films including The Departed (2006), 12 Years a Slave (2013), and Moonlight (2016). His involvement behind the camera earned him widespread respect as a producer.

Pitt’s acting also earned him critical acclaim in later years. His performances in The Curious Case of Benjamin Button (2008) and Moneyball (2011) earned him Academy Award nominations. Finally, in 2020, he won his first acting Oscar for Best Supporting Actor for his role as Cliff Booth in Quentin Tarantino’s Once Upon a Time in Hollywood (2019).


Personal Life

Brad Pitt’s personal life has often been in the spotlight. He married actress Jennifer Aniston in 2000, but the marriage ended in 2005. Soon after, his relationship with Angelina Jolie, his co-star from Mr. & Mrs. Smith, became public. The couple, nicknamed “Brangelina,” married in 2014 but divorced in 2016. Together, they share six children, three of whom were adopted internationally.

Despite publicized struggles, Pitt has spoken openly about self-improvement, sobriety, and focusing on his family.


Philanthropy

Brad Pitt is deeply involved in humanitarian efforts. He co-founded the Make It Right Foundation, which built homes for victims of Hurricane Katrina in New Orleans. Along with Angelina Jolie, he also supported global initiatives through the Jolie-Pitt Foundation, donating millions to causes such as education, healthcare, and human rights.
